Responsibilities:
PURPOSE STATEMENT:
Plan, develop and coordinate continuing nursing in-service education programs within the facility for all clinical and non-clinical nursing staff in a positive, empathetic, and professional manner at all times. Recognize that patient safety is a top priority.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
· Assess educational needs and develop/coordinate necessary education programs.
· Coordinate orientation programs for new clinical staff.
· Act a general resource for nursing staff.
· Work with hospital leadership and staff to assess current educational needs and develops a plan to satisfy those needs.
· Collaborate with medical practitioners and Director of Nursing to incorporate nursing processes into the plan of care for patients.
· Provide educational leadership to patients and care providers to enhance specialized patient care within established clinical protocol.
· Assist patient and caregivers with education needs, problem solution and health management across the continuum of care.
· Implement and deliver educational curricula as required by regulatory agencies such as Joint Commission, CARF, CMS and State agencies.
· Initiate clinical skills development programs for direct care staff.
· Educate direct patient care staff in the use of equipment, supplies, and coordinates in-service training for appropriate staff.
· Provide specialized nursing protocols for direct care staff.
· Develop training and implementation as needed.
Qualifications:
E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E/SKILL REQUIREMENTS:
· Associate or Bachelor’s degree in Nursing or Education required. Master's degree in nursing or related field preferred.
· Three or more years’ clinical experience combined with/or related to teaching experience required.
· One or more years’ behavioral health experience required.
